Summary
A profession that extracts fibers from kudzu roots, spins them into yarn by hand, and weaves kudzu cloth by hand weaving.
Description
Kudzu cloth manufacturing workers extract fibers from kudzu roots, wash and dry them, spin into yarn by hand, and weave fabric on a loom. Primarily traditional handcraft and small-scale production in workshops, handling multiple processes including material quality control, loom adjustment, and finishing (steaming, sun-bleaching). To maintain regional culture and value as craft products, proficient skills and meticulous attention are required.
Future Outlook
Successor shortages in traditional crafts are an issue, but demand remains steady from regional revitalization and cultural preservation perspectives. New markets are anticipated from the expansion of tourism and experiential workshops.
